正在回答
1回答
你好同学,你可以这样理解,像如下红框中,实际上就是调用了add(),只不过通过call这个方法去调用add。
而第一个参数是设置this的执向,所以这里是通过call方法来让add中的this指向subs . 所以如果add里面有this,那么指向的会是subs. 因为add中没有用到this,所以第一个参数设置null也可以哦。所以并没有谁替换谁,只不过通过call这个方法,让add中的this指向subs,这样执行add里面的内容,就相当于subs也拥有了add的方法哦。

祝学习愉快 ,望采纳。

恭喜解决一个难题,获得1积分~
来为老师/同学的回答评分吧
0 星